2 definitions found From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48 [gcide]: Carnassial \Car*nas"si*al\, a. [Cf. F. carnassier carnivorous, and L. caro, carnis, flesh.] (Anat.) Adapted to eating flesh. -- n. A carnassial tooth; especially, the last premolar in many carnivores. [1913 Webster] From WordNet (r) 2.0 [wn]: carnassial adj : (of a tooth) adapted for shearing flesh; "the carnassial teeth of carnivores"
